PETALING JAYA: Property developer SP Setia deeply regrets the collapse of a pedestrian bridge under construction at the company's Abdullah Hukum project site.
"At approximately 3.30pm, the pedestrian link to Mid Valley which is still under construction gave way. Fire and Rescue Services, police and medical services together with the Department of Occupational Safety and Health were immediately notified of the incident. The project team is still assessing the situation and is working closely with the relevant authorities," said SP Setia in a press release on Wednesday.
At least one person was killed and four people injured when the pedestrian bridge collapsed.
City Fire and Rescue Department chief operations officer Samsol Maarif Saibani earlier said the department was alerted about the incident at 3.33pm.
